Output 23e4345f4b3cd809059f93830da5615d8eed342933bf8dd204f0cb08769900aa:0

value
33859408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 611a32c662784ddda2a272a73de33ea57d1e20eb OP_EQUAL
address
MGkbAL7LYjWbJMhgzkGqsDDupqrAhzNMZR
transaction
23e4345f4b3cd809059f93830da5615d8eed342933bf8dd204f0cb08769900aa
spent
true